The Adventures of Sherlock Holmes: The Adventure of the Speckled Band

This audiobook is narrated by an AI Voice. *The Adventure of the Speckled Band* ranks among Arthur Conan Doyle’s most celebrated and terrifying Sherlock Holmes mysteries, a masterclass in deduction, suspense and creeping horror set in the shadowy Surrey countryside.

Early one morning, a distraught young woman named Helen Stoner arrives at 221B Baker Street seeking urgent help from Sherlock Holmes. She lives with her violent, hot-tempered stepfather, Dr. Grimesby Roylott, the last heir of the once wealthy Roylott family of Stoke Moran Manor. Two years prior, Helen’s twin sister Julia died under baffling, dreadful circumstances shortly before her wedding. Her final terrified words were: “Oh, my God! Helen! It was the band! The speckled band!”

Now Helen faces the same fate. Renovations force her to move into Julia’s old bedroom, and she has begun hearing the low, mysterious whistle that haunted her sister on the night of her death. Fearful for her own life and trapped by her menacing stepfather, she begs Holmes and Watson to uncover the truth.

Holmes traces a powerful motive: under their mother’s will, each daughter gains a substantial annual income upon marriage, a prospect that would ruin Dr. Roylott financially. Travelling to the isolated manor house, Holmes uncovers a string of eerie clues: a useless dummy bell-rope, a tiny ventilator connecting the two bedrooms, and a bed bolted firmly to the floor.

That night, Holmes and Watson keep a grim vigil inside the fatal bedroom. What unfolds reveals the horrifying meaning of “the speckled band”, a diabolical murder plot using an exotic weapon from India. A shocking twist of fate delivers justice to the scheming villain, and Holmes unravels every thread of this unforgettable Gothic thriller.
